Tara’s acting debut, however, will always be fondly remembered by every 2000s kid. The stunner starred in the Disney Channel sitcom The Suite Life of Karan & Kabir in 2012, quickly making her way into our hearts with the role of Vinnie.
However, Tara’s expertise far exceeds acting. She actually began her career as a singer in 2010 on the Disney India reality show Big Bada Boom. Being a professional singer since seven years of age, she has and continues to sing in operas, performing with some of the best musicians in the country, such as The Godafather of Indian Jazz — Louiz Banks.
